Transaction 5368048f11aef543bea5f4936eb77b65be1419818d0fa82077e692907a22d820

1 Input
2 Outputs
  • 5368048f11aef543bea5f4936eb77b65be1419818d0fa82077e692907a22d820:0
  • value  2603099
    address  16feZTKjpDzjQzVXWeENeUeNe3aCXVW3yf
  • 5368048f11aef543bea5f4936eb77b65be1419818d0fa82077e692907a22d820:1
  • value  24903
    address  1FYTnaVHzuNYdK5MDHTfsZWPm1uqFUdu3S